FirePro M3900 has an age advantage of 3 years, a 100% higher maximum VRAM amount, a 63% more advanced lithography process, and 345% lower power consumption.

We couldn't decide between FireGL V5600 and FirePro M3900. We've got no test results to judge.

Be aware that FireGL V5600 is a workstation graphics card while FirePro M3900 is a mobile workstation one.
